Bonner, Sarah; Chen, Peggy; Jones, Kristi; Milonovich, Brandon – Applied Measurement in Education, 2021
We describe the use of think alouds to examine substantive processes involved in performance on a formative assessment of computational thinking (CT) designed to support self-regulated learning (SRL). Our task design model included three phases of work on a computational thinking problem: forethought, performance, and reflection. The cognitive…
